How they compare
United States currently reports 1.87 against 1.75 in Russia, a difference of 0.12.
That makes United States's figure about 1.1 times Russia's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1992 it was United States ahead.
Russia ranks 34th and United States ranks 31st of 78 countries.
United States has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Russia | United States |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.887 | 1.46 | 0.5722 | United States |
| 2000s | 1.05 | 1.5 | 0.4478 | United States |
| 2010s | 1.4 | 1.73 | 0.331 | United States |
| 2020s | 1.72 | 1.91 | 0.1894 | United States |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
